A wake-up device, which responds to noises caused by vehicles and generates a wake-up signal indicating the presence of such vehicles, has at least one sensor (10) for receiving the vehicle noises and signal processing (11) for the electrical output signals of the at least one sensor (10). In order to create a wake-up device with a large detection range and a high detection probability with a low false alarm rate without the need for complex signal processing, the signal processing has at least two signal processing channels in which level signals with different signal properties are derived from the output signals of the at least one sensor (10) and by means of estimation filters (16 , 17) and decision logics (18, 19), physically interpretable characteristics are extracted from the level signals and the confidence of the extraction is assessed. With the extracted features and their confidence, the estimation filters (16) are influenced with regard to the mode of operation, the function parameters to be set and the decision thresholds.
